Location: Northern Africa, bordering the Mediterranean Sea, between Egypt and Tunisia
Industries: petroleum, iron and steel, food processing, textiles, handicrafts, cement
Geography: more than 90% of the country is desert or semidesert
Area: total: 1,759,540 sq km
land: 1,759,540 sq
water: 0 sq km
Budget: revenues: $39.85 billion
expenditures: $19.47 billion (2007 est.)
Languages: Arabic, Italian, English, all are widely understood in the major cities
National Holiday: Revolution Day, 1 September (1969)
Currency (Code): Libyan dinar (LYD)
Capital: Tripoli
Population: 6,173,579, note: includes 166,510 non-nationals (July 2008 est.)
Labor Force: 1.83 million (2007 est.)
Exports: $40.47 billion f.o.b. (2007 est.)
Imports: $14.47 billion f.o.b. (2007 est.)
Internet Country Code: .ly
Airports: 141 (2007) / Paved Runways: 60
Aircraft Departures: 5,900
